10
Dividend policy (in the case of a
trust, distribution policy) on the
increased capital (interests)
On 20 December 2011 the Company announced a Dividend
Policy stating that Kingsrose intends, to the extend permissible
under the Corporations Act and the Company’s Constitution,
to pay an annual dividend to shareholders, subject to capital
expenditure requirements, acquisition activity and liquidity
needs. Franking will be subject to the composition of income.

The Policy will periodically be reviewed by the Board to ensure
it complies with any applicable legal requirements and
remains relevant and effective and may be amended by the
Board of Kingsrose by resolution.

The Policyis not intended to be contractual in nature.
